Job overview
The Clinical Therapist (LCSW, LPC, LMFT, LMHC) role at SOL Mental Health involves providing expert mental health care while contributing to a supportive and collaborative clinical environment that prioritizes professional growth and patient outcomes.
Responsibilities and impact
The therapist will provide treatment to diverse patient populations using evidence-based clinical methods, collaborate with peers and leadership, participate in supervision, and contribute to an integrated care model to enhance patient and clinician satisfaction.
Compensation and benefits
The position offers competitive compensation up to $120,000 DOE, medical benefits including health, dental, and vision coverage, 401k with employer match, paid time off, 10 paid holidays, an annual CME budget, and administrative and billing support.
Experience and skills
Candidates must be fully licensed in New York with 2+ years of experience treating adults, young adults, or adolescents, skilled in evidence-based treatments and crisis interventions, with excellent clinical knowledge and communication skills.
Career development
SOL Mental Health provides a structured career advancement pathway, regular supervision from industry leaders, and a culture of continuous learning and collaboration to support professional growth.
Work environment and culture
The company fosters a culture of collaboration, continuous learning, engaged leadership, and values diversity, inclusion, and clinical excellence in a hybrid work environment with 3 days in-office and 2 days remote.
Company information
SOL Mental Health is a mental health care provider focused on redefining care with a supportive and collaborative work environment, integrated care models, and a commitment to diversity and inclusion.
Team overview
The therapist will join a team supported by engaged leadership and peers, working collaboratively within an integrated care model to enhance outcomes and satisfaction.
Job location and travel
This is a hybrid position based in New York, requiring 3 days in-office and 2 days remote work.
